Transaction 08573885495c8488e897f995f73d9bb696c42a650d5136cfe2e773c62b8d873d

1 Input
1 Outputs
  • 08573885495c8488e897f995f73d9bb696c42a650d5136cfe2e773c62b8d873d:0
  • value  70608
    address  17StnGroPUsNXBq4AVJQ1fqGftoFZh3zva